How Is an Ordered Set Used in Real-World Scenarios?
Ordered sets are used extensively in real-world scenarios, such as ranking items, determining the order of events, and modeling social networks. For example, in a movie database, ordered sets can be used to rank movies by rating, release date, or genre.

An ordered set is a collection of elements that can be arranged in a specific order. This order is usually determined by a binary relation, which is a way of comparing two elements to determine their relationship. For example, in a set of numbers, the binary relation could be greater than or less than. Ordered sets are used to model real-world scenarios, such as ranking items or determining the order of events.
